Our Approach: A User-Centric Design Process

At Braine Agency, we follow a structured and user-centered design process to ensure that our solutions are effective and aligned with our clients' business goals. Our approach for [Client Name] involved the following key steps:

  1. Discovery & Research: We began by conducting thorough user research to understand the needs, pain points, and behaviors of [Client Name]'s target audience. This involved:
    • User Interviews: We conducted in-depth interviews with existing and potential users to gather qualitative data about their experiences.
    • Usability Testing: We observed users interacting with the existing [Platform] to identify usability issues and areas for improvement.
    • Analytics Review: We analyzed website analytics data to identify patterns in user behavior, such as drop-off points and popular pages. We found that 70% of users abandoned their cart before completing the purchase.
    • Competitive Analysis: We researched the UI/UX design of competitor websites to identify best practices and opportunities for differentiation.
  2. Information Architecture (IA) & Wireframing: Based on our research findings, we restructured the information architecture to improve navigation and make it easier for users to find what they need. We then created low-fidelity wireframes to visualize the layout and flow of key pages.
  3. UI Design & Prototyping: We developed a modern and visually appealing UI design that aligned with [Client Name]'s brand identity. We also created interactive prototypes to test the usability of the design and gather feedback. The design incorporated elements of [mention specific design trends, e.g., minimalist design, micro-interactions].
  4. Usability Testing & Iteration: We conducted further usability testing on the prototypes to identify any remaining issues and iterate on the design based on user feedback. This involved A/B testing different design elements, such as button placement and call-to-action wording.
  5. Development & Implementation: We worked closely with [Client Name]'s development team to ensure that the final design was implemented accurately and efficiently. We also provided ongoing support and guidance throughout the development process.

Key UI/UX Improvements: A Detailed Breakdown

The UI/UX improvements we implemented for [Client Name] focused on addressing the key challenges identified during the discovery phase. Here's a detailed breakdown of the changes we made:

Improved Navigation

We simplified the navigation menu and implemented a clear and intuitive information architecture. This involved:

  • Restructuring the main navigation: We reduced the number of menu items and grouped related items together.
  • Implementing a mega menu: For categories with a large number of subcategories, we implemented a mega menu to provide a visual overview of the available options.
  • Adding a prominent search bar: We made the search bar more visible and accessible on all pages.
  • Implementing breadcrumb navigation: We added breadcrumb navigation to help users understand their location within the website and easily navigate back to previous pages.

Modernized Visual Design

We updated the visual design to create a more modern and engaging user experience. This involved:

  • Refreshing the color palette: We updated the color palette to align with [Client Name]'s brand identity and create a more visually appealing aesthetic.
  • Improving typography: We selected a more readable and visually appealing typeface.
  • Using high-quality imagery: We replaced outdated or low-quality images with high-quality visuals that showcased [Client Name]'s products and services.
  • Adding white space: We increased the amount of white space to improve readability and create a more visually balanced design.

Optimized for Mobile

We ensured that the [Platform] was fully optimized for mobile devices, providing a seamless experience for users on smartphones and tablets. This involved:

  • Implementing a responsive design: We used responsive design principles to ensure that the website adapted seamlessly to different screen sizes.
  • Optimizing images for mobile: We optimized images for mobile devices to reduce loading times.
  • Simplifying navigation for mobile: We simplified the navigation menu for mobile devices, using a hamburger menu to conserve screen space.
  • Ensuring touch-friendliness: We made sure that all buttons and links were large enough to be easily tapped on mobile devices.

Simplified Checkout Process

We streamlined the checkout process to reduce cart abandonment rates. This involved:

  • Reducing the number of steps: We simplified the checkout process by reducing the number of steps required to complete a purchase.
  • Offering guest checkout: We allowed users to checkout without creating an account.
  • Providing clear and concise instructions: We provided clear and concise instructions at each step of the checkout process.
  • Offering multiple payment options: We offered a variety of payment options, including credit cards, PayPal, and other popular payment methods.
  • Implementing a progress bar: We added a progress bar to show users how far they were in the checkout process.
  • Improving error handling: We improved error handling to provide clear and helpful error messages to users.

Performance Optimization

Addressing slow loading times was crucial. We implemented several performance optimizations, including:

  • Image optimization: Compressing images without sacrificing quality.
  • Code minification: Reducing the size of CSS and JavaScript files.
  • Caching: Implementing browser and server-side caching.
  • Content Delivery Network (CDN): Utilizing a CDN to distribute content geographically.

Lessons Learned: Key Takeaways for UI/UX Success

This project provided valuable insights into the importance of user-centered design and the impact of UI/UX improvements. Some key takeaways include:

  • User research is essential: Understanding user needs and behaviors is critical to creating an effective UI/UX design.
  • Simplicity is key: A clean and intuitive design is more effective than a complex and cluttered one.
  • Mobile optimization is crucial: Ensuring a seamless experience on mobile devices is essential in today's mobile-first world.
  • Continuous iteration is necessary: UI/UX design is an ongoing process that requires continuous testing and iteration based on user feedback.
